Joint Contribution and Shared Benefits | Zhejiang Lab Nano Fabrication Center is Officially Launched
Date: 2023-05-30

Recently, Zhejiang Lab (ZJ Lab) held the Forum of Micro and Nano Technology in the Post-Moore's Law Period and the Press Conference on the Nano Fabrication Center, then it officially opened the Zhejiang Lab Nano Fabrication Center to the public for the first time.

With the slowdown of Moore's Law, semiconductor manufacturing is approaching the physical limit, and the post-Moore's Law period is coming. Under such circumstances, micro and nano processing and fabrication become an indispensable sci-tech infrastructure platform for the development of the semiconductor industry. It is also a significant sign of measuring high-end fabrication capability and basic scientific research level.

"The micro and nano processing technology in the post-Moore's Law period is of significance to strengthening China's independent sci-tech innovation ability and international competitiveness. In addition, it will serve as a major pillar for developing information technology, artificial intelligence, Internet of Things, and data centers. ZJ Lab's Nano Fabrication Center has technical processes covering new materials, internationally advanced micro and nano processing equipment, and a team of young and professional engineers. I am convinced the center will help ZJ Lab create a world-leading base for fundamental research and innovation of intelligent computing. I look forward to closer cooperation with ZJ Lab to enhance scientific research and innovation for micro and nano processing", noted YANG Jianyi, Director of ZJU-Hangzhou Innovation Center for Science and Technology in his speech.

YU Hui, a Research Expert at ZJ Lab, introduced that the Lab officially started the construction of the Nano Fabrication Center in June 2021, which was put into trial operation in December 2022. The center has been engaging in the Lab's relevant scientific research projects, fully verifying its processing and testing capabilities.

Covering a floor area of 3,000 m2, the center's clean room is equipped with four major technologies, optoelectronic fusion integration, intelligent sensor, 3D advanced packaging, and new CMOS devices. "It can basically cover most of the original research work, with capability of small-scale mass production", said YU Hui.
